The Breadwinner is a 2026 American comedy film directed by Eric Appel and written Nate Bargatze and Dan Lagana. The film follows a father of three (Bargatze, in his film debut) who must hold down the house while his wife (Mandy Moore) is on a business trip. Colin Jost, Zach Cherry, Martin Herlihy, Kumail Nanjiani, and Will Forte also star.
The film will be released in the United States on May 29, 2026. The film received negative reviews from critics.
After his wife lands a deal on Shark Tank, Nate Wilcox has to become a stay-at-home dad.

In November 2024, TriStar Pictures acquired the rights to Nate Bargatze’s The Breadwinner, a preemptive acquisition while the screenplay was still being written. Wonder Project, a conservative faith-based production company, partnered to produce the movie. In February 2025, it was announced that Eric Appel would direct the film. In May 2025, Mandy Moore, Will Forte, Colin Jost, Kumail Nanjiani, Zach Cherry, Kate Berlant, and Martin Herlihy were cast in the film. Principal photography began on May 22, 2025, in Atlanta. Leo Birenberg and Zach Robinson composed the film's score, after having collaborated with Appel on Weird: The Al Yankovic Story.
The Breadwinner was first released in the Philippines on May 27. 2026, and in the United States on May 29, 2026. It was previously scheduled to release on March 13, 2026.
In the United States and Canada, The Breadwinner is projected to gross around $8 million from 3,300 theaters in its opening weekend.
On the review aggregator website Rotten Tomatoes, 31% of 13 critics' reviews are positive, with an average rating of 4/10. Metacritic, which uses a weighted average, assigned the film a score of 32 out of 100, based on 5 critics, indicating "generally unfavorable" reviews.
